table
8 sub-components for composable tables. Fully compatible with phx-update="stream" for server-side streaming.
Sub-components: table_header/1, table_body/1, table_row/1, table_head/1, table_cell/1, table_caption/1, table_footer/1
<%!-- Basic table --%>
<.table>
<.table_header>
<.table_row>
<.table_head>Name</.table_head>
<.table_head>Email</.table_head>
<.table_head>Status</.table_head>
<.table_head>Joined</.table_head>
<.table_head class="w-[50px]"></.table_head>
</.table_row>
</.table_header>
<.table_body>
<.table_row :for={user <- @users} id={"user-#{user.id}"}>
<.table_cell class="font-medium"><%= user.name %></.table_cell>
<.table_cell><%= user.email %></.table_cell>
<.table_cell>
<.badge variant={status_variant(user.status)}><%= user.status %></.badge>
</.table_cell>
<.table_cell class="text-muted-foreground">
<%= Calendar.strftime(user.inserted_at, "%b %d, %Y") %>
</.table_cell>
<.table_cell>
<.dropdown_menu id={"user-menu-#{user.id}"}>
<:trigger><.button variant="ghost" size="icon"><.icon name="more-horizontal" /></.button></:trigger>
<:content>
<.dropdown_menu_item phx-click="edit-user" phx-value-id={user.id}>Edit</.dropdown_menu_item>
<.dropdown_menu_item phx-click="delete-user" phx-value-id={user.id}>Delete</.dropdown_menu_item>
</:content>
</.dropdown_menu>
</.table_cell>
</.table_row>
</.table_body>
</.table>
<%!-- With streaming and LiveView streams --%>
<.table>
<.table_body id="users-stream" phx-update="stream">
<.table_row :for={{dom_id, user} <- @streams.users} id={dom_id}>
<.table_cell><%= user.name %></.table_cell>
<.table_cell><%= user.email %></.table_cell>
</.table_row>
</.table_body>
</.table>def mount(_params, _session, socket) do
{:ok, stream(socket, :users, Accounts.list_users())}
end
def handle_info({:user_created, user}, socket) do
{:noreply, stream_insert(socket, :users, user, at: 0)}
enddata_grid
Sortable data table with phx-click sort events and direction cycling.
Attrs: columns (list of maps), rows, sort_by, sort_dir, on_sort (event name), id
<.data_grid
id="orders-grid"
rows={@orders}
columns={[
%{key: "order_id", label: "Order #", sortable: true},
%{key: "customer", label: "Customer", sortable: true},
%{key: "total", label: "Total", sortable: true},
%{key: "status", label: "Status", sortable: false},
%{key: "created_at", label: "Date", sortable: true}
]}
sort_by={@sort_by}
sort_dir={@sort_dir}
on_sort="sort_orders"
/>def mount(_params, _session, socket) do
{:ok, assign(socket,
sort_by: "created_at",
sort_dir: "desc",
orders: Orders.list(sort_by: "created_at", sort_dir: :desc)
)}
end
def handle_event("sort_orders", %{"key" => key, "dir" => dir}, socket) do
sort_dir = String.to_existing_atom(dir)
{:noreply, assign(socket,
sort_by: key,
sort_dir: dir,
orders: Orders.list(sort_by: key, sort_dir: sort_dir)
)}
endchart / phia_chart
ECharts integration. Supports area, bar, line, pie, scatter, and radar chart types.
Hook: PhiaChart
Attrs: id, type (atom), title, description, series, labels, height, options (raw ECharts map)
<%!-- Area chart --%>
<.phia_chart
id="revenue-chart"
type={:area}
title="Monthly Revenue"
description="Last 12 months"
series={[%{name: "MRR", data: @mrr_data}]}
labels={@month_labels}
height="320px"
/>
<%!-- Grouped bar chart --%>
<.phia_chart
id="comparison-chart"
type={:bar}
title="Q1 vs Q2"
series={[
%{name: "Q1 2025", data: [42, 58, 63, 71, 68, 75]},
%{name: "Q2 2025", data: [55, 62, 78, 85, 92, 88]}
]}
labels={["Jan", "Feb", "Mar", "Apr", "May", "Jun"]}
height="300px"
/>
<%!-- Pie chart --%>
<.phia_chart
id="status-pie"
type={:pie}
title="Ticket Status"
series={[%{
name: "Status",
data: [
%{name: "Open", value: 42},
%{name: "Pending", value: 23},
%{name: "Closed", value: 135}
]
}]}
height="280px"
/>
<%!-- Live-updating chart via push_event --%>
<.phia_chart id="live-chart" type={:line} series={@series} labels={@labels} height="260px" /># Update chart data from LiveView
def handle_info(:update_chart, socket) do
series = [%{name: "Active Users", data: Metrics.last_24h()}]
{:noreply,
socket
|> assign(series: series)
|> push_event("phia-chart-update:live-chart", %{series: series})}
endchart_shell

Dynamic query builder with field/operator/value rule rows.
Attrs: fields (list of %{name, label, type, options}), rules, on_add, on_remove, on_change
<.filter_builder
fields={[
%{name: "name", label: "Name", type: "text"},
%{name: "status", label: "Status", type: "select",
options: [{"Active", "active"}, {"Inactive", "inactive"}]},
%{name: "role", label: "Role", type: "select",
options: [{"Admin", "admin"}, {"Member", "member"}]},
%{name: "created_at", label: "Created At", type: "date"},
%{name: "age", label: "Age", type: "number"}
]}
rules={@filter_rules}
on_add="add_filter_rule"
on_remove="remove_filter_rule"
on_change="update_filter_rule"
/>def handle_event("add_filter_rule", _params, socket) do
new_rule = %{id: Ecto.UUID.generate(), field: "name", op: "contains", value: ""}
{:noreply, update(socket, :filter_rules, &[&1 | [new_rule]])}
end
def handle_event("remove_filter_rule", %{"id" => id}, socket) do
{:noreply, update(socket, :filter_rules, &Enum.reject(&1, fn r -> r.id == id end))}
endbulk_action_bar

Segmented uptime visualization. Each segment is a day/interval with status.
Attrs: segments (list of %{status: :up/:down/:degraded, date, tooltip}), show_legend
<.card>
<.card_header>
<.card_title>API Uptime — Last 90 days</.card_title>
<.card_description>
<.badge variant="default">99.98% uptime</.badge>
</.card_description>
</.card_header>
<.card_content>
<.uptime_bar segments={@uptime_segments} show_legend={true} />
</.card_content>
</.card># Build segments from incident history
def uptime_segments(incidents, days \\ 90) do
today = Date.utc_today()
Enum.map(0..days-1, fn offset ->
date = Date.add(today, -offset)
status = if incident = Enum.find(incidents, &(&1.date == date)) do
if incident.degraded, do: :degraded, else: :down
else
:up
end
%{date: date, status: status, tooltip: Date.to_string(date)}
end)
|> Enum.reverse()
end
